The History of the Christmas Card

17 November 2011

Get in the mood for the holiday season by coming along to December's seminar at Archives for London (AfL) when Anna Flood of the British Postal Museum and Archive will explore the custom of sending Christmas cards.

Using images from the BMPA's collections, Anna will highlight popular card themes and the way they were produced while revealing some of the reasons for sending them.
